Amino acid sequence: The sequence of the first five N-terminal amino acids was determined and was found to be, Ala-Pro-Met-Gly-Ser.
Macrophage Inflammatory Protein-1 beta Human Recombinant produced in E.Coli is a single, non-glycosylated, polypeptide chain containing 69 amino acids and having a molecular mass of 7620 Dalton. The CCL4 is purified by proprietary chromatographic techniques.
Formulation:Lyophilized from a concentrated (1mg/ml) solution in water containing no additives.
Physical Appearance:Sterile Filtered White lyophilized (freeze-dried) powder.
Purity:Greater than 99.0% as determined by:(a) Analysis by RP-HPLC.(b) Analysis by SDS-PAGE.
Source:Escherichia Coli.
Stability:Lyophilized MIP-1b although stable at room temperature for 3 weeks, should be stored desiccated below -18°C. Upon reconstitution CCL4 should be stored at 4°C between 2-7 days and for future use below -18°C. For long term storage it is recommended to add a carrier protein (0.1% HSA or BSA).Please prevent freeze-thaw cycles.
